Management Commentary

During the recent earnings call, Hancock Whitney management highlighted a solid start to 2026, with first-quarter EPS of $1.52 reflecting disciplined expense control and stable net interest income. Executives noted that loan growth remained modest, driven by selective commercial lending opportunities, while deposit levels held steady amid a competitive environment. Credit quality trends were described as generally stable, with nonperforming assets slightly elevated but within expectations due to a few isolated credits. The team emphasized ongoing investments in digital banking and wealth management to deepen client relationships and improve efficiency. Management also pointed to a potential tailwind from lower short-term rates, which could ease funding cost pressures in the coming quarters. However, they cautioned that economic uncertainty persists, particularly around commercial real estate exposure and consumer health. Overall, the commentary struck a balanced tone, expressing confidence in the bank's conservative underwriting and capital position while acknowledging headwinds from loan demand and margin compression. Forward Guidance

Looking ahead, Hancock Whitney management provided tempered forward guidance during the recent earnings call, reflecting a cautious yet measured outlook for the remainder of 2026. The company anticipates that net interest income could stabilize in the coming quarters, supported by an improved deposit mix and modest loan growth in its core markets across the Gulf South. However, executives noted that persistent inflationary pressures and uncertainty around the pace of potential Federal Reserve rate adjustments may continue to influence margin dynamics. On the expense front, the bank expects to maintain disciplined cost management, with potential for modest efficiency gains through ongoing digital transformation initiatives. Credit quality appears manageable, with management indicating that net charge-offs could remain near normalized levels, though they remain watchful of stress in certain commercial real estate segments. While no specific numeric guidance was provided for full-year earnings, management expressed confidence in the bank’s ability to generate organic growth through relationship-based lending and fee income expansion. The outlook assumes a slowly improving economic environment in its footprint, but the bank remains positioned to adjust should conditions deteriorate. Overall, Hancock Whitney’s forward guidance suggests a pragmatic path, balancing growth aspirations with cautious risk management in an uneven macroeconomic landscape. Market Reaction

The market responded favorably to Hancock’s (HWC) recently released first-quarter 2026 results, with the stock gaining ground in the session following the earnings announcement. The reported earnings per share of $1.52 exceeded many analyst expectations, prompting several firms to update their models. While revenue data was not provided in the release, the strong bottom-line performance appeared to reassure investors who had been concerned about net interest margin compression in the regional banking sector. Trading volume on the day was notably above average, reflecting heightened investor interest. Several analysts noted that the beat may signal effective cost management and a stable loan portfolio, potentially underpinning near-term sentiment. The stock price moved higher, though gains were modest, suggesting the market is still weighing broader macroeconomic headwinds. Options activity indicated a slight shift toward bullish positioning, but volumes remained within normal ranges. Overall, the initial market reaction points to cautious optimism. The earnings beat, while not transformative, could provide a floor for the stock if the company maintains its discipline. Investors now appear focused on upcoming economic data and the company’s ability to sustain its momentum in the next quarter.
